Preoperative pregabalin 150 mg cuts pain and opioid use after laparoscopic cholecystectomyPregabalin May Reduce Pain After Gallbladder Surgery

Key Takeaway
Consider a single 150 mg preoperative pregabalin dose to reduce pain and opioid use after laparoscopic cholecystectomy, but watch for sedation.

This is a meta-analysis of randomized controlled trials evaluating the effect of a single 150 mg dose of pregabalin given preoperatively compared with control in patients undergoing laparoscopic cholecystectomy. The primary outcome was 24-hour postoperative pain scores, with secondary outcomes including opioid consumption (fentanyl and tramadol), sedation, postoperative nausea, vomiting, and headache.

Pooled results showed that pregabalin significantly reduced 24-hour postoperative pain scores (SMD = 0.80 lower; 95% CI, 1.42 to 0.18 lower; p = 0.01). Opioid consumption was also reduced: fentanyl consumption was lower (SMD = 1.24 lower; p = 0.002) and tramadol consumption was lower (SMD = 4.21 lower; p = 0.002).

Sedation was slightly increased with pregabalin, but this was not statistically significant. No significant differences were observed for postoperative nausea, vomiting, or headache. The authors report an acceptable safety profile, though specific adverse events were not detailed.

A key limitation is high statistical heterogeneity for pain scores (I-squared = 81%), which suggests variability across studies and limits the precision of the pooled estimate. The certainty of evidence was not reported.

In practice, these findings support the use of a single 150 mg preoperative dose of pregabalin as part of a multimodal analgesic strategy for laparoscopic cholecystectomy. However, clinicians should weigh the modest benefit against the slight increase in sedation and the heterogeneity of the evidence.

How this fits prior evidence

This meta-analysis extends prior coverage on multimodal analgesia by showing that pregabalin, a gabapentinoid, reduces postoperative pain and opioid consumption after laparoscopic cholecystectomy, similar to how dexmedetomidine added to TAP block reduced tramadol consumption and pain scores in cesarean sections. It also complements the finding that serratus anterior plane block reduces opioid consumption and nausea, though pregabalin did not significantly affect nausea. However, given the prior association of gabapentinoids with modestly higher odds of Alzheimer's disease and related dementias, the long-term safety of pregabalin in this setting remains a consideration.

Researchers looked at how a single 150 mg dose of pregabalin given before surgery affects patients undergoing laparoscopic cholecystectomy. This type of surgery is used to remove the gallbladder. The study compared patients who received the medication against those who did not.

The results showed that patients who received the pregabalin had significantly lower pain scores during the first 24 hours after surgery. Additionally, these patients required less fentanyl and tramadol, which are common opioid medications used to manage pain. While there was a slight increase in sedation levels for some patients, this change was not considered statistically significant.

Other side effects like nausea, vomiting, or headaches did not show significant differences between the two groups. The study noted that while the data showed an association, it is only one part of a broader pain management plan. Because the data had high statistical heterogeneity for pain scores, these results should be viewed as supportive evidence rather than a definitive rule.

What this means for you:
A single pre-operative dose of pregabalin may lower post-surgical pain and reduce opioid use after gallbladder surgery.

Effective postoperative pain control is essential following laparoscopic cholecystectomy, yet the analgesic value of a standardised 150 mg preoperative dose of pregabalin has not been clearly established. This systematic review and meta-analysis synthesised evidence from seven randomised controlled trials published between 2008 and 2025 to evaluate the efficacy and safety of pregabalin when administered before surgery. Four trials reported 24-hour postoperative pain scores, and pooled analysis demonstrated that pregabalin significantly reduced pain compared with control (SMD = 0.80 lower; 95% CI, 1.42 to 0.18 lower; p = 0.01), although statistical heterogeneity was high (I-squared = 81%). Pregabalin also produced notable reductions in opioid consumption, including fentanyl (SMD = 1.24 lower; p = 0.002) and tramadol (SMD = 4.21 lower; p = 0.002), again with considerable variability across studies. Sedation was slightly increased but did not reach statistical significance, and there were no significant differences in postoperative nausea, vomiting, or headache. Sensitivity analyses supported the stability of these findings. Overall, the results indicate that a single 150 mg preoperative dose of pregabalin meaningfully reduces postoperative pain and opioid requirements following laparoscopic cholecystectomy while maintaining an acceptable safety profile, supporting its use as part of a multimodal analgesic strategy.
